Assertion: `CaCO_(3)` is prepared by passing carbon dioxide gas through slaked lime.
Reason: Passingg excess of `CO_(2)` through slaked lime leads to the formation off quick lime.
A. If both assertion and reason are true and reason is the correct explanation of assertion
B. If both assertion and reason are true but reason is not the correct explanation of assertion
C. If assertion is true but reason is false.
D. If both assertion and reason are false.

Correct Answer – C
`underset(“Slaked lime”)(Ca(OH)_(2)+CO_(2) to CaCO_(3)+H_(2)O`
